Didn't find class "com.google.firebase.provider.FirebaseInitProvider"
2017-09-13 17:25
4199 查看
在运行app时,出现了以下错误:
解决办法:
在项目的Application中添加以下代码
注:此application继承自MultiDexApplication
E/AndroidRuntime: FATAL EXCEPTION: main java.lang.RuntimeException: Unable to get provider com.google.firebase.provider.FirebaseInitProvider: java.lang.ClassNotFoundException: Didn't find class "com.google.firebase.provider.FirebaseInitProvider" on path: DexPathList[dexElements=[zip file "/data/app/com.longcai.musicshop-1.apk"],nativeLibraryDirectories=[/data/app-lib/com.longcai.musicshop-1, /vendor/lib, /system/lib]] at android.app.ActivityThread.installProvider(ActivityThread.java:5115) at android.app.ActivityThread.installContentProviders(ActivityThread.java:4670) at android.app.ActivityThread.handleBindApplication(ActivityThread.java:4606) at android.app.ActivityThread.access$1300(ActivityThread.java:162) at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1414) at android.os.Handler.dispatchMessage(Handler.java:99) at android.os.Looper.loop(Looper.java:153) at android.app.ActivityThread.main(ActivityThread.java:5383) at java.lang.reflect.Method.invokeNative(Native Method) at jav a678 a.lang.reflect.Method.invoke(Method.java:511) at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:853) at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:620) at dalvik.system.NativeStart.main(Native Method) Caused by: java.lang.ClassNotFoundException: Didn't find class "com.google.firebase.provider.FirebaseInitProvider" on path: DexPathList[dexElements=[zip file "/data/app/com.longcai.musicshop-1.apk"],nativeLibraryDirectories=[/data/app-lib/com.longcai.musicshop-1, /vendor/lib, /system/lib]] at dalvik.system.BaseDexClassLoader.findClass(BaseDexClassLoader.java:53) at java.lang.ClassLoader.loadClass(ClassLoader.java:501) at java.lang.ClassLoader.loadClass(ClassLoader.java:461) at android.app.ActivityThread.installProvider(ActivityThread.java:5100) at android.app.ActivityThread.installContentProviders(ActivityThread.java:4670) at android.app.ActivityThread.handleBindApplication(ActivityThread.java:4606) at android.app.ActivityThread.access$1300(ActivityThread.java:162) at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1414) at android.os.Handler.dispatchMessage(Handler.java:99) at android.os.Looper.loop(Looper.java:153) at android.app.ActivityThread.main(ActivityThread.java:5383) at java.lang.reflect.Method.invokeNative(Native Method) at java.lang.reflect.Method.invoke(Method.java:511) at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:853) at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:620) at dalvik.system.NativeStart.main(Native Method)
解决办法:
在项目的Application中添加以下代码
@Override protected void attachBaseContext(Context base) { super.attachBaseContext(base); MultiDex.install(this); }
注:此application继承自MultiDexApplication
相关文章推荐
- Exception in thread "main" java.lang.UnsupportedClassVersionError: com/google/common/base/Function : Unsupported major.minor version 52.0的解决办法(图文详解)
- React Native 集成到 Android 原生项目中踩坑记录 (Didn't find class "com.facebook.jni.IteratorHelper")
- Android Studio-Didn't find class XXX on path: DexPathList [zip file "/data/app/packagename/base.apk]
- Android Studio-Didn't find class XXX on path: DexPathList [zip file "/data/app/packagename/base.apk]
- Android studio报:Caused by: java.lang.ClassNotFoundException: Didn't find class "xhs.com.view.ParentV
- React Native 集成Android原生应用:Didn't find class "com.facebook.jni.IteratorHelper"
- Warning:com.google.common.base.Absent: can't find referenced class javax.annotation.Nullable
- Android - Failed to find provider info for com.google.settings in MapView Example
- Caused by: java.lang.ClassNotFoundException: Didn't find class "net.grandcentrix.tray.provider.TrayC
- java.lang.ClassNotFoundException: Didn't find class "com.example.slidemenu.view.SlideMen
- Exception in thread "main" java.lang.NoClassDefFoundError: com/google/common/base/Function问题解决
- Caused by: java.lang.ClassNotFoundException: Didn't find class "com.yinuo.parking.app.MyApplication"
- Didn't find class "com.android.tools.fd.runtime.BootstrapApplication"
- java.lang.ClassNotFoundException: Didn't find class "com.mob.wenda.MainActivity"
- org.hibernate.PropertyNotFoundException: Could not find a getter for employee in class com.itcast.f_hbm_oneToMany.Department
- Exception in thread "main" java.lang.NoClassDefFoundError: com/google/common/base/Function问题解决
- eclipse with android : Didn't find class "com.xx.xx.MainActivity" on path: DexPathList
- Didn't find class "com.android.tools.fd.runtime.BootstrapApplication"
- Android studio报:Caused by: java.lang.ClassNotFoundException: Didn't find class "xhs.com.view.ParentV